Palamuru-Rangareddy Lift Irrigation Scheme
Dam in Telangana, India From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
The Palamuru-Rangareddy Lift Irrigation Project (PRLIP) is an irrigation project in the state of Telangana, India.[1] The project aims to make 12.3 lakh acres of parched lands in erstwhile combined Mahabubnagar district into fertile lands.[2] The project is built on the Krishna river at a cost of ₹ 35,000 crore in Nagarkurnool district.[3][4] On 16 September 2023, Telangana Chief Minister K. Chandrashekar Rao operationalised the first phase of Palamuru-Rangareddy Lift Irrigation Scheme at Yellur-Narlapur pump house in Nagarkurnool district.[5][6] The project will change the future of six districts viz, Nagarkurnool, Mahabubnagar, Nalgonda, Rangareddy, Vikarabad in South Telangana.[7][8]

History
Chief Minister Kalvakuntla Chandrashekhar Rao laid the foundation stone of irrigation project on 11 June 2015.[9] The project aims to divert 70 TMC of flood water from Krishna River at Jurala project.
